package sudoku.project;
import java.util.ArrayList;
import java.util.Collections;
import java.util.List;
import java.util.Random;
import javafx.application.Application;
import javafx.event.ActionEvent;
import javafx.event.EventHandler;
import javafx.event.EventType;
import javafx.geometry.Insets;
import javafx.scene.Scene;
import javafx.scene.control.Button;
import javafx.scene.control.Label;
import javafx.scene.control.TextField;
import javafx.scene.layout.Background;
import javafx.scene.layout.BackgroundFill;
import javafx.scene.layout.ColumnConstraints;
import javafx.scene.layout.CornerRadii;
import javafx.scene.layout.GridPane;
import javafx.scene.layout.RowConstraints;
import javafx.scene.layout.StackPane;
import javafx.scene.paint.Paint;
import javafx.scene.shape.Line;
import javafx.stage.Stage;
/**
*
* @author Play4u
*/
public class SudokuProject extends Application {
public void addTextBoxes(GridPane root, TextField[] matrix) {
int counter = 0;
for (int i = 0; i < 11; i++) {
for (int j = 0; j < 11; j++) {
if (i != 3 && i != 7 && j != 3 && j != 7) {
GridPane.setConstraints(matrix[counter], j, i);
// GridPane.setFillWidth(matrix[counter], true);
GridPane.setFillHeight(matrix[counter], true);
root.getChildren().add(matrix[counter]);
counter++;
}
}
}
}
public void setBorders(GridPane root) {
int[] verticalIndex = {3, 7};
int[] horizontIndex = {3, 7};
for (int i = 0; i < verticalIndex.length; i++) {
Line border = new Line();
GridPane.setConstraints(border, verticalIndex[i], 0, 1, 11);
border.setStartX(12.5);
border.setStartY(0);
border.setEndX(12.5);
border.setEndY(270);
border.setStrokeWidth(4);
root.getChildren().add(border);
}
for (int j = 0; j < horizontIndex.length; j++) {
Line border = new Line();
GridPane.setConstraints(border, 0, horizontIndex[j], 11, 1);
border.setStartX(0);
border.setStartY(12.5);
border.setEndX(325);
border.setEndY(12.5);
border.setStrokeWidth(4);
root.getChildren().add(border);
}
}
public void setPlayingField(GridPane root) {
final int rowsConst = 11;
final int colConst = 11;
for (int i = 0; i < rowsConst; i++) {
if (i == 3 || i == 7) {
ColumnConstraints cConst = new ColumnConstraints(5);
root.getColumnConstraints().add(cConst);
} else {
ColumnConstraints cConst = new ColumnConstraints(35);
root.getColumnConstraints().add(cConst);
}
}
for (int i = 0; i < rowsConst; i++) {
if (i == 3 || i == 7) {
RowConstraints rConst = new RowConstraints(5);
root.getRowConstraints().add(rConst);
} else {
RowConstraints rConst = new RowConstraints(30);
root.getRowConstraints().add(rConst);
}
}
}
public void initialize(TextField[] grid){
SolIter temp = new SolIter();
int[][] matrix = temp.getSolutionMatrix();
for (int i = 0; i < 9; i++){
for (int j = 0; j < 9; j++){
grid[i*9 + j].setText(Integer.toString(matrix[i][j]));
}
}
}
@Override
public void start(Stage primaryStage) {
primaryStage.setResizable(true);
GridPane gameGrid = new GridPane();
Scene scene = new Scene(gameGrid, 400, 400);
gameGrid.setPadding(new Insets(10, 10, 10, 10));
TextField[] gameMatrix = new TextField[81];
for (int i = 0; i < 81; i++) {
gameMatrix[i] = new TextField();
}
//gameGrid.setGridLinesVisible(true);
setPlayingField(gameGrid);
addTextBoxes(gameGrid, gameMatrix);
setBorders(gameGrid);
Button btn = new Button("Generate");
btn.setOnAction((event) -> {initialize(gameMatrix);});
GridPane.setConstraints(btn, 3, 13, 3, 1);
gameGrid.getChildren().add(btn);
initialize(gameMatrix);
primaryStage.setTitle("Sudoku");
primaryStage.setScene(scene);
primaryStage.show();
}
public static void main(String[] args) {
launch(args);
}
}
